Subido por William Joel Chávez López

DMM - U1T1A1 Investigación

Anuncio
CARRERA: TSU. DESARROLLO DE SOFTWARE
MULTIPLTAFORMA
ASIGNATURA: DESARROLLO MOVIL MULTIPLATAFORMA
PROFESOR: QUINTAL PACHECO CESAR ALBERTO
NOMBRE: WILLIAM JOEL CHAVEZ LOPEZ
GRUPO: SM52
Aplicaciones nativas
El término app nativa se utiliza para referirse a plataformas como Mac y PC, con ejemplos
como las aplicaciones Fotos, Correo o Contactos que están preinstaladas y configuradas
en cada ordenador. Sin embargo, en el contexto de las aplicaciones web móviles, el
término aplicación nativa se utiliza para referirse a cualquier aplicación escrita para
funcionar en una plataforma de dispositivo específica.
Las dos principales plataformas de sistemas operativos móviles son iOS de Apple y
Android de Google. Las aplicaciones nativas se escriben en el código utilizado
preliminarmente para el dispositivo y su sistema operativo.
Aplicaciones multiplataforma
Las aplicaciones multiplataforma son apps que se caracterizan por ser creadas bajo un
único lenguaje de programación que facilita su exportación y por tanto su visualización en
cualquier tipo de dispositivo independientemente de su sistema operativo. Al ser
desarrolladas con un mismo lenguaje, sólo son necesarios unos cambios mínimos para su
completa adaptación a cualquier dispositivo, ya sea móvil, ordenador o tablet, entre otros.
TIPOS DE APPS
NATIVA
MULTIPLATAFORMA
Ventajas
Ventajas
• Las aplicaciones estan disponibles desde
• Las apps se pueden subir a las diferentes
la App Store
tiendas de las plataformas.
• Excelente rendimiento
• Tiempo de desarrollo menor.
• Menor costo de desarrollo comparado a
una app nativa.
Desventajas
Desventajas
• Desarrollo mas costoso.
• Diferente rendimiento en los dispositivos.
• El codigo es exclusivo y no puede usarse
• Sus funciones se limitan dependiendo al
en otra plataforma diferente.
dispositivo en el cual estan siendo
ejecutadas.
• Se necesita conocer varios leguages de
desarrollo para las diferentes plataformas
Bibliografia
González, D. B. (2021, 27 diciembre). Principales tipos de aplicaciones móviles:
ventajas, desventajas y ejemplos. Profile Software Services.
https://profile.es/blog/tipos-aplicaciones-moviles-ventajasejemplos/#:%7E:text=Pros%3A%20es%20multiplataforma%20y%20permite%20su
bir%20la%20app,rendimiento%20medio%20en%20multitud%20de%20aspectos%
20en%20general.
Aplicaciones móviles nativas vs no nativas: ¿cuál es la diferencia? (2020, 28
noviembre). ICHI.PRO. https://ichi.pro/es/aplicaciones-moviles-nativas-vs-nonativas-cual-es-la-diferencia-197526651170642
Gillis, A. S. (2020, 1 septiembre). native app. SearchSoftwareQuality.
https://searchsoftwarequality.techtarget.com/definition/native-application-nativeapp#:%7E:text=The%20term%20native%20app%20is%20used%20to%20refer,to
%20work%20on%20a%20specific%20device%20platform.%20
Y. (2020, 16 junio). Aplicaciones multiplataforma: cómo desarrollarlas en HTML5.
Yeeply. https://www.yeeply.com/blog/programar-apps-multiplataforma-html5/
Descargar